Why did we outsource part of our production?

Those who have been following the life of the ZOEANDCO brand for a long time may remember that clothing has appeared in our collections several times before. However, only a few know why we put this branch of the brand on hold for a while -despite our love for clothing. In this post, I’ll share a bit about that.

Over the past 6-8 years, textile prices have multiplied internationally. With the depreciation of the Hungarian Forint and the lack of local textile manufacturers, the Hungarian fashion industry has become heavily restricted. Besides the shortage of raw materials, production itself has also become increasingly difficult, as the sewing profession is not being renewed. Instead of seamstresses and tailors, fashion designers and textile engineers graduate from vocational training. The film industry, which has largely moved to Hungary, has also absorbed the best craftsmen, further reducing the number of skilled workers. Meanwhile, the few sewing workshops that remain in Hungary are not prepared to meet the needs of small and micro businesses: minimum orders of several hundred pieces are not only unnecessary for a 1-2 person company, but also financially and physically (in terms of storage) overwhelming. Given the current market unpredictability, this path is simply not feasible for a brand like ours.

Because of these challenges, in recent years we decided to focus on other things until we could find a production solution that is both financially viable and ensures the high quality we aim for.

In August 2024, when we launched the Je Suis Yours Truly brand, we discovered a production method that allowed us to bring clothing back into our range - not custom-made cuts, but premium-quality garments printed or embroidered with our own designs. We work with partners in Poland, Lithuania, the Netherlands, and Spain. Which partner produces and ships a specific order depends on the garment’s availability and the delivery address - 90% of the time, the partner closest to the destination fulfills the order, making the process more efficient and sustainable. This method has opened a new door for us, giving our creativity a huge opportunity to flourish - without taking on too much risk or endangering the survival of the brand with poorly calculated inventory. That’s why we decided to include these made-to-order embroidered or printed clothes in the ZOEANDCO range alongside the JSYT brand.
